Common use
Glycomet SR tablet is used to treat type 2 diabetes mellitus. It works by reducing glucose absorption from food and decreasing glucose production in the liver. In addition to diabetes, Glycomet is also used to treat Polycystic Ovary Syndrome (PCOS) in women.
Dosage and direction
Swallow the tablet whole with a glass of water. Do not chew, crush, or break the tablet, as this can impact its effectiveness. Always take this medicine with your evening meal to maximize its effects and minimize gastrointestinal discomfort. Follow your doctor's instructions regarding the dosage and frequency. Never adjust the dose without consulting your doctor first.
Precautions
Pregnancy: Caution is advised while taking Glycomet SR tablet if you are pregnant. It is best to consult your doctor before taking this medicine.
Congestive Heart Failure: Patients suffering from congestive heart failure requiring pharmacological treatment should exercise caution when taking this medication as it could increase their risk for lactic acidosis.
Alcohol: While on Glycomet SR, avoid excessive intake of alcohol as it may increase the risk of lactic acidosis, a rare but serious side effect.
Contraindications
Renal Impairment: Patients with severe renal impairment should avoid using Glycomet SR tablet as it could exacerbate their condition and increase the risk of lactic acidosis.
Metabolic Acidosis: This medicine is contraindicated in patients with acute or chronic metabolic acidosis, including diabetic ketoacidosis, as it may worsen their condition.
Allergy: If you are allergic to any component of Glycomet SR, avoid using this medication and consult your doctor for an alternative prescription.
Possible side effect
Glycomet SR may cause some common side effects, including diarrhea, nausea or vomiting, flatulence, indigestion, headache, and abdominal discomfort.
Drug interaction
Thiazides and other diuretics: These medicines can increase blood sugar levels, potentially affecting the glucose control provided by Glycomet SR. Examples include hydrochlorothiazide and furosemide.
Corticosteroids: Medicines like prednisone and dexamethasone can elevate blood sugar levels, reducing the efficacy of Glycomet SR in managing diabetes.
Medicines for your thyroid gland: These can lead to increased blood sugar levels, impacting the glucose-lowering effect of Glycomet SR. L-thyroxine is an example.
Missed dose
If you forget to take your regular dose of the Glycomet SR, take it as soon as you remember. But if it's nearly time for your next dose, skip the missed one and continue with your regular schedule. Never increase your dosage without consulting with your doctor.
Overdose
If you accidentally take more Glycomet SR than prescribed, you may experience common symptoms like nausea, stomach discomfort, or diarrhea. Make sure you inform your doctor about it.
Storage
Keep the Glycomet SR in a well-closed, light-resistant container. Store it at a controlled room temperature between 20 C and 25 C. Avoid exposing the medication to excessive heat, humidity, or direct sunlight. Always keep this medicine out of reach of children. Make sure to use before its expiry date.
